Ticket: Config drift in Farehawk pricing experiment

Welcome aboard. Since you're new to the Farehawk stack, some context: our ticket-pricing experiment (variant weights for the Brindle Festival presale) is supposed to be identical across staging and production. Last week someone hand-edited the staging experiment flags, so the discount tiers no longer match what the analysts signed off on. Please reconcile staging against the approved set. For reference, the approved production values are as follows.

service settings:
PRAWYN_PIN=9848
PRAWYN_METRICS_HOST=metrics.prawyn.lumicworks.corp
PRAWYN_LOG_LEVEL=warn
PRAWYN_TENANT=pelius

Subject: Fan-out cut-over complete

Hi Ravela,

The Pigeonline notification fan-out moved to the bounded-queue model at 03:10 with no dropped deliveries. Backpressure now pauses producers instead of shedding load, and consumer lag stayed under two seconds throughout. Dashboards were green for the full soak window. The service is running with the following configuration:

service settings:
PRAIX_LOG_LEVEL=error
PRAIX_METRICS_HOST=metrics.praix.qorvelcorp.corp
PRAIX_POOL_SIZE=16

2024-11-12 — Rotated the release signing key for SquatWatch, our typo-squatting package scanner, after the old key passed its 90-day window. All builds from v2.3.1 onward must verify against the new key; older artifacts remain valid against the archived one. Update your local verification config before pulling the next release. The new signing key is as follows.

release key, kawif-hawep: bky13_X7TGuRG4Zu4ZJ

## Onboarding: PickPath Optimizer — Security Review Notes

PickPath computes optimized pick-lists for Harrowgate Fulfillment's three regional warehouses. The optimizer service runs in an isolated subnet; all route requests are signed, and audit logs are retained for ninety days. Reviewers should confirm that the solver container has no outbound network access beyond the metrics relay. Access to the sealed configuration vault requires the recovery passphrase held by the platform team, reproduced below for this review.

unlock words, kawig-bawef: belax-sorir-druax-ulaiel-wenael-belael